Titanic II Set for 2027 Launch by Australian Billionaire
Clive Palmer revives his ambitious project, aiming to outdo the original Titanic in luxury and safety.
- Australian billionaire Clive Palmer announces plans to build Titanic II, aiming for a 2027 launch.
- The replica aims to be 'far superior' to the original, with a cost estimated between $500 million and $1 billion.
- Palmer's previous attempts in 2012 and 2018 were stalled, but he now seeks to re-engage partners and find a shipbuilder by year's end.
- Titanic II will replicate the original's voyage from Southampton to New York, with nearly half of its rooms reserved for first-class passengers.
- Palmer, with a net worth of $4.2 billion, dismisses skepticism and emphasizes the project's potential for promoting peace.
